[url=http://meincmagazine.com/civis/viewtopic.php?p=28090509#p28090509:2xcwkw9k said:Sufinsil[/url]":2xcwkw9k]For those that think it is simply a coat of paint...
https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=_iTw4EL_gAc#t=88
Original Grey. PS classic logo
Etched in Button Symbols
Plate signifying which unit you have
Grey Vertical Stand
Grey DS4. Home button classic Logo. Touchpad with button etching
PS Camera. Grey. PS classic logo.
I know it is not much more than spray painting your current unit, but there is more than "just a coat of paint".
